I use FDCC with my favorite partners in order to save time during playing. But my opponents complain that they sometimes don't see the explanations. For artificial bids I must mark them manually that they are artificial, otherwise these bids will not be marked red-framed. The text "artificial" is not so striking as the red frame. And if the opponents click on the predefined bids and I don't want to or cannot give more information, the original text disappears from the bid and appears "no information available".
If I examine a played hand with the hand viewer's movie, I don't see the FDCC's explanations any more, not even the manual alerts. As far as I can remember, earlier I saw at least the alerts. Has it be changed in the newest version of BBO?

The web version of BBO does not support FD properly. Since the Windows version has been deprecated for 5 years or so, this essentially means that FD is dead.
